I like to verb ~のが好きです、~ことが好きです
I like to cook. 私は料理をするのが好きです。 watashi wa ryouri wo suru noga suki desu
I like to watch TV. 私はテレビを見るのが好きです。 watashi wa terebi wo miru noga suki desu
I like to study Japanese. 私は日本語を勉強するのが好きです。 watashi wa nihongo wo benkyousuru noga suki desu

I think 私は紅茶が飲みたいです。 means "I want to drink tea" or "I'd like to drink tea". But "I like drinking tea" or "I like to drink tea" should be 紅茶を飲むことが好きです。Both English and Japanese aren't my native languages, so I hope there are no mistakes.
